Bomb Blast at Wenzhou Police Station: Suspect Detained

A man has been detained on suspicion of detonating a bomb outside a Wenzhou Police station. The blast happened at 09:36 this morning, June 12.

An eyewitness report stated that after the initial blast, a man tried to detonate a second bomb, but was stopped by police officers. The bomb was clearly homemade and contained ball bearings and screws.

The identity of the suspect is as yet, unknown, but he was heard speaking the Wenzhou local dialect, according to witnesses.

There were no injuries and the man’s motive is yet to be determined.

The attack comes just days after a man in Hubei province was shot to death by police after entering a primary school with a homemade bomb, and attempting to take a class of six year olds hostage.
